As you probably know; male African Bullfrog will grow big and strong and are aggressive eaters. So if you plant in the bottom... the plants will probably get trampled. Now I think that if enclosure was big enough you could get away with some hardy grasses in pots on a protected area. Plants in pots on background would prevent trampling; but I would be careful that plants are totally out of his jumping range, specially if toxic.
Reason I state that is because my African Bullfrog would get all excited at feeding time and once jumped up 6 in. in air and grabbed a weighted fake silk plant and took it down while staring at me. I held the plant in my hand and threw in a worm so he released the plant and went for worm. That was the last decor I placed in his habitat other than his cave and dish. Also, when smaller, I did notice once a little silk fern was missing the tip of a leave. My guess is he lounged at a cricket on the leaf and took part of it too. Lucky for us he passed it and did not get impacted. Good luck and post pics once you got your plant decor done!
